Obsolete computers and old electronics are valuable sources for secondary raw materials if recycled; otherwise, these devices are a source of toxins and carcinogens. Rapid technology change, low initial cost, and planned obsolescence have resulted in a fast-growing surplus of computers and other electronic components around the globe. Technical solutions are available, but in most cases a legal framework, collection system, logistics, and other services need to be implemented before applying a technical solution. The u.S. Environmental protection agency, estimates 30 to 40 million surplus pcs, classified as "Hazardous household waste", would be ready for end-of-life management in the next few years. The u.S. National safety council estimates that 75% of all personal computers ever sold are now surplus electronics. In america, companies are liable for compliance with regulations even if the recycling process is outsourced under the resource conservation and recovery act. Companies can mitigate these risks by requiring waivers of liability, audit trails, certificates of data destruction, signed confidentiality agreements, and random audits of information security. The national association of information destruction is an international trade association for data destruction providers. In 2009, 38% of computers and a quarter of total electronic waste was recycled in the united states, 5% and 3% up from 3 years prior respectively.
